The Bath County School board will meet on Tuesday, June 7, 2022 at Millboro Elementary School, at 7:00 pm.

Bath County School Board Regular Monthly Meeting

Tuesday, June 7, 2022

at Millboro Elementary School

Closed Meeting convenes immediately after opening at 5:30 PM.

Open Meeting begins at 7:00 PM.

1. MEETING OPENING

A. Call Meeting to Order

B. Convene into Closed Meeting

C. Return to Open Meeting and Certification of Closed Meeting

2. PUBLIC MEETING

A. Pledge of Allegiance and Moment of Silence

B. Approve or Amend Agenda

C. Public Comments

3. GOOD NEWS IN BATH COUNTY PUBLIC SCHOOLS

4. CONSENT AGENDA

A. Minutes

B. Claims

C. Attendance Report

D. Cafeteria Report

E. Maintenance Report

F. Transportation Report

G. Approval of Consent Agenda

5. PRESENTATIONS/INFORMATION

A. Vaping

6. ACTION ITEMS

A. Action Following Closed Meeting

B. Digital Mapping Program for Virginia K-12 Schools

C. Project RETURN for SY2022-2023

D. Approve SY2022-2023 School Board Meetings Schedule/Location

E. Approve VSBA Policy Services Agreement

F. VSBA Policy Update – 1st Reading

7. INFORMATIONAL ITEMS FOR BOARD MEMBERS

8. CLOSING OF MEETING
